ROOF 2025 - Tucked away in Westwood Acres South, this private 1-acre property offers peaceful country living with beautiful sunset views and a stunning backdrop of a 16, 000-acre cattle farm behind the home. Built in 2007, this double-wide mobile home is move-in ready and packed with extras for anyone looking for space, privacy, and a true homestead feel. Inside, you’ll find laminate flooring throughout the main living areas, carpet in the bedrooms, and a spacious primary suite with a walk-in closet. The home also includes washer and dryer, and all furniture conveys, making this an easy transition for a full-time residence, seasonal getaway, or investment opportunity. Outside is where this property really shines. The massive 40x36 detached garage offers approximately 1, 000 additional square feet of usable space with workshop lighting, freezer and refrigerator included, plus a toilet flange already installed for a future bathroom addition. The garage features a 10-foot garage door in the front, and there’s also an additional shed/workshop behind the garage for even more storage or hobby space. The property is fully fenced and includes a newer roof, well and septic, double-pane windows, front and back porches, rain barrel, smoker, propane BBQ grill, and even a ride-on mower that stays with the property. Located on an unpaved road for added privacy and that true country atmosphere, this is the perfect setup for your mini farm, homestead, or anyone wanting room to spread out and enjoy quiet rural living.
